Failed to import schema to the service backend using 'ldifde.exe'.

It then rolls back everything. Is my AD too big?

The problem is not related to the size of your AD, since Adaxes doesn't extend the Active Directory schema.
During the installation, Adaxes extends the schema of the ADAM instance installed by the product.

Unfortunately we can't reproduce your problem in out environment.
The error occurs because the installation fails to launch ldifde.exe to extend the schema of the backend. It looks like the file is either missing or inaccessible.
Please check whether ldifde.exe is present in the C:\WINDOWS\ADAM\ folder and whether this file is accessible.
